One thing that I enjoy reading in other blog's is what curriculum they use. I thought I would share:
I have used all A Beka up until this year. On Tuesday, I teach at a HS (homeschool) enrichment ministry www.timothyministry.org I have been teaching there for 5 years now. This is where my girls have been getting their Science and History from, along with other fun classes. One of the main reason we go to Timothy is the dance program they offer. Both girls have been dancing since they were 3. The dance ministry is called : For His Glory. It is a Christ centered program with out a major expense of local dance company. The girls are invited to join the Ministry Team at the age of 10. We have two more years to go. Scottlyn prays that when she is 10 she will be invited if it is God's will.
This year I made a leap and brought Science and History home. I have tried to do something that would go along with their classes at home, but nothing ever stick's. A good friend of mine introduce me to MFW. I fell in loved with it! Eurka, it is so simple and the girls are getting so much out of it. It a keeper!
The classical concept has always appealed to me. Most of all the girls enjoy the timeline's and note booking. This helps them but together what we are reading and get a better understanding. I am trying to put this in my sidebar? This blogging thing is going to be an adventure and an education

Scottlyn {4th grade}
Arithmetic A Beka
Language Arts A Beka
Bible: Boy, Have I Got Problems
History, Science, Music: MFW Exploration to 1850
Geography Challenge @ Timothy
Piano: 3rd year
Ballet, Tap & Jazz
Shalyn {1st grade}
Arithmetic A Beka
Math Mania @ Timothy
Language Arts A Beka
Bible: Boy, Have I Got Problems
History, Science, Music: MFW Exploration to 1850
Ballet & Tap
